    Parasomnia (Shudder)- 9/10

    I will be reviewing this a little more in depth on my next podcast but this sweet little gem from 2008 was something i missed initially. Basic story revolves around a young woman who has what we call parasomnia (sleep disorder) where she often times spends more time sleeping and dreaming than actually awake. While visiting a friend in the mental ward where she stays a young man sees her and instantly falls in love and begins to befriend her while visiting a few times.

    In the midst of all this is the guy next door to her room who is a notorious serial killer (Patrick Kilpatrick) who has the ability to hypnotize people and make them either kill themselves or others. And somehow while at the ward has managed to make a psychic connection with the girl even having the ability to use her any way he wants. The movie has some top notch kill scenes and doesnt shy away from the gore but it also has a nice little love story involved which adds a nice touch to the ending and so on.
